Small Changes, Amplified Security Margins

In encryption, tiny data shifts expand into significant hash differences—a property exploited in integrity checks. Hash functions transform inputs into fixed-length outputs where even a single bit change produces a completely distinct result. This sensitivity, like the Doppler shift, ensures that tampering is not just detectable but computationally impractical.
